The Judicial Council of California, based in Alameda, CA, serves as the policymaking body for the California court system. It is responsible for ensuring the consistent administration of justice throughout the state.
By setting statewide policies and guidelines, the Judicial Council plays a crucial role in supporting the fair and efficient operation of California's court system. Its decisions impact various aspects of the legal process, from case management to judicial education.
